From Shiba Inu to Squid Game: Meme Coins on the Rise

The copyright world is wild, dude. It's like a rollercoaster ride of emotions, and right now, meme coins are taking center stage. From the adorable Shiba Inu to the action-packed Squid Game, these digital assets are taking over faster than you can say "to the moon!" It all started with Dogecoin, the OG meme coin, which skyrocketed in value thanks to the power of social media and celebrity endorsements. Now, a whole wave of new meme coins is launching, each with its own unique story and loyal community.

These aren't your typical cryptocurrencies, though. Meme coins are often created as jokes or inside references and rely heavily on hype and speculation. But don't underestimate them! Some have seen truly incredible gains, making early investors very happy indeed. Of course, there's also the risk of rug pulls and scams, so be careful out there, folks.

DeFi's New Plaything: Meme Coins Take Center Stage

Decentralized Finance boomed in recent years, attracting investors desiring high returns. But the latest trend rattling the DeFi space isn't your typical yield farm or lending protocol. Instead, it's an surge of meme coins, digital assets forged from internet culture and fueled by viral buzz.

These aren't your average cryptocurrencies. Meme coins often lack utility, relying solely on community support and social media exposure. Their worth can fluctuate wildly, tempting investors with the promise of quick riches but also putting them to significant losses.

Despite the concerns, meme coins have become an defining trend in DeFi, grabbing the attention of investors worldwide.
